Memoir as a form of auto-ethnographic research for exploring the practice of transnational higher education in China
In this paper, I argue that memoir, as a form of auto-ethnographic research, is an appropriate method for exploring the complexities and singularities in the practice of western educational practitioners who are immersed in the social reality of offshore higher education institutions, such as those...
